Strider 2

Publisher: Capcom
Developer: Capcom
Release Date: 7/13/2000
Date Played: 7/29/2018
Region: USA
Time Played: 11 minutes
What’d you think?: An arcade classic, this went as all arcade games do, with a lot of fun for a very short time. You go in blind and aren’t ready for some little part and it just eats you up.
YouTube Link:

Leave a Reply